From d65d6e8760afbd7f70b22a1f3297a037bc475fea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Peter Kjellerstedt Date: Mon, 15 May 2017 10:21:08 +0200 Subject: [PATCH 11/13] Do not require that ELF binaries are executable to be identifiable There is nothing that requires, e.g., a DSO to be executable, but it is still an ELF binary and should be identified as such. Upstream probably expects all ELF binaries to be marked as executable, but rather than imposing such a limitation for OE, allow any file to be identified as an ELF binary regardless of whether it is executable or not.
